These devices connect with mobile apps on the back end to provide extensive merchant and customer services. Small companies have a choice of reasonably priced mobile card readers - some even come free - that they can purchase outright or pay for through monthly plans. A mobile card reader serves as the electronic link connecting merchants with an mPOS system that’s designed to allow a simple swipe or tap to accept credit and debit card payments for purchases. A POS system runs on your mobile device using software to process transactions, just like a traditional POS terminal. Mobile point-of-sale systems can be used anywhere and function independently of elaborate merchant services.
